2024-03-04[bugfix/tracing] fix broken tracing due to conflicting schema url (#2712)Libravatar Milas Bowman1
The OpenTelemetry SDK is very strict about the schema version when the `Resource` is initialized. Specifically, different schema versions _CANNOT_ be mixed, and since the default SDK resource (which is merged with the user-defined one) defines a schema URL, the `semconv` imports are really prone to being out-of-sync. The best way to avoid this is to merge a _schemaless_ resource. This is fine...there's plenty of other ways to get `semconv` out of sync, and the core service attributes (e.g. `service.name`) should not ever change. Additionally, any errors here are now propagated so that they'll be visible instead of silently swallowed.
